The international technology communityโs attention converged on Manchester Metropolitan University as it proudly hosted the 5th International Conference on Computing and Communication Networks (ICCCNet-2025) from August 1โ3, 2025. Over three dynamic days of knowledge exchange, research presentations, and networking, the conference reached its pinnacle with a prestigious awards ceremony honoring a select group of visionary leaders and innovators. These trailblazers are redefining the boundaries of technology and driving transformative change across diverse sectors.
Distinguished for its rigorous academic standards and global reach, ICCCNet-2025 has once again solidified its position as a premier stage for unveiling pioneering research and industry-shaping breakthroughs. This yearโs proceedings have been approved for publication in the renowned Springer Lecture Notes in Networks and Systems (LNNS) series and will be indexed in leading academic databases, ensuring that the conferenceโs contributions are accessible to scholars, practitioners, and industry leaders worldwide.

Omkar Bhalekar, a Senior Network Engineer working at Tesla and a pioneer in Industrial Network Design and Cybersecurity, was awarded the Distinguished Award for Infrastructure Resiliency, recognising his unmatched contributions in transforming high-volume EV manufacturing and Battery technology. Bhalekar revolutionised production by integrating non-traditional data center networking technology into factory operations, enhancing both resilience and high-speed data flow, which was one of the reasons Tesla Fremont Factory was recognised as North Americaโs most productive car manufacturing facility. Under his leadership, he and his team spearheaded the automation of over 4,000 networked SuperChargers, deploying AI-driven orchestration that streamlined workflows, optimised energy use, and cut operational costs by $20 million annually.
